Well folks it feels like Christmas over here. The day finally arrived where I'd make some gains towards profiting again. Today I put in a 7k hand session and ended up 6 bis. I would attribute it to a couple of things. I have now become a lot more aggressive post flop, always making sure I have control of the hand. I am finding that you can really bluff the regs with a fair amount of ease by just bloating the pot and barreling huge on the river. This was not the case before as I'd just check behind on the flop, flat a turn bet etc etc. Another adjustment I've made is my 3bet size in multiway pots. Before it was way to small and I'd be semi confused with huge hands post flop. But now by juicing the 3bet size up a bit the decisions are pretty clear cut. These tweaks are thanks to some discussion with friend and fellow 100NL reg krissyb24 and also 2+2 pro lyda12345.
I don't think I ran particularly well today - no set over sets, I did get As vs Ks. But I also got coolered a bunch of times. Basically it just seems weekends are way more fishy. Instead of having like 6 regs at the table and 1 fish, it's like 3 or 4 regs at the table and 5 fish. It's pretty much the nuts. So yeah playing on the weekends is mandatory from now on.

Now your probably scratching your head wondering what each different line means. Well the green line is money you actually won. The red line is money you won through non-showdowns (bluffing etc). And the blue line takes the EV of your allins before the river so as you can see I'm running -$260 below expected value. And that blue doesn't even take coolers into account.
